Subject: Re: [PATCH 08/33] virtio_ring: introduce dma sync api for virtio
Date: Fri, 3 Feb 2023 04:24:30 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20230203042103-mutt-send-email-mst@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20230202110058.130695-9-xuanzhuo@linux.alibaba.com>

On Thu, Feb 02, 2023 at 07:00:33PM +0800, Xuan Zhuo wrote:
> In the process of dma sync, we involved whether virtio uses dma api. On
> the other hand, it is also necessary to read vdev->dev.parent. So these
> API has been introduced.

you don't need to repeat implementation here.
just list the new APIs and how they will be used
with premapped API.



> Signed-off-by: Xuan Zhuo <xuanzhuo@linux.alibaba.com>
> ---
>  dr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c | 61 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
>  include/linux/virtio.h       |  8 +++++
>  2 files changed, 69 insertions(+)
> 
> diff --git a/dr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c b/dr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c
> index 67eda7bc23ea..7b393133fd27 100644
> --- a/dr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c
> +++ b/drivers/virtio/virtio_ring.c
> @@ -3102,4 +3102,65 @@ void virtio_dma_unmap(struct device *dev, dma_addr_t dma, unsigned int length,
>  }
>  E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(virtio_dma_unmap);
>  
> +/**
> + * virtio_dma_need_sync - check dma address need sync

.... whether a dma address needs sync

> + * @dev: virtio device
> + * @addr: DMA address
> + */
> +bool virtio_dma_need_sync(struct device *dev, dma_addr_t addr)
> +{
> +	struct virtio_device *vdev = dev_to_virtio(dev);
> +
> +	if (!vring_use_dma_api(vdev))
> +		return 0;
> +
> +	return dma_need_sync(vdev->dev.parent, addr);
> +}
> +E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(virtio_dma_need_sync);
> +
> +/**
> + * virtio_dma_sync_signle_range_for_cpu - dma sync for cpu
> + * @dev: virtio device
> + * @addr: DMA address
> + * @offset: DMA address offset
> + * @size: mem size for sync
> + * @dir: DMA direction
> + *
> + * Before calling this function, use virtio_dma_need_sync() to confirm that the
> + * DMA address really needs to be synchronized
> + */
> +void virtio_dma_sync_signle_range_for_cpu(struct device *dev, dma_addr_t addr,
> +					  unsigned long offset, size_t size,
> +					  enum dma_data_direction dir)
> +{
> +	struct virtio_device *vdev = dev_to_virtio(dev);
> +
> +	dma_sync_single_range_for_cpu(vdev->dev.parent, addr, offset,
> +				      size, DMA_BIDIRECTIONAL);
> +}
> +E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(virtio_dma_sync_signle_range_for_cpu);
> +
> +/**
> + * virtio_dma_sync_signle_range_for_device - dma sync for device
> + * @dev: virtio device
> + * @addr: DMA address
> + * @offset: DMA address offset
> + * @size: mem size for sync
> + * @dir: DMA direction
> + *
> + * Before calling this function, use virtio_dma_need_sync() to confirm that the
> + * DMA address really needs to be synchronized
> + */
> +void virtio_dma_sync_signle_range_for_device(struct device *dev,
> +					     dma_addr_t addr,
> +					     unsigned long offset, size_t size,
> +					     enum dma_data_direction dir)
> +{
> +	struct virtio_device *vdev = dev_to_virtio(dev);
> +
> +	dma_sync_single_range_for_device(vdev->dev.parent, addr, offset,
> +					 size, DMA_BIDIRECTIONAL);
> +}
> +E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(virtio_dma_sync_signle_range_for_device);
> +


Pls document how these APIs are only for pre-mapped buffers,
for non premapped virtio core handles DMA API internally.
